Butterfly Network (BFLY) Is Up 8.1% After Raising 2026 Revenue Outlook And Embedded Growth Outlook

Simply Wall St·07/31/2026 22:32:27
Listen to the news
  • In the past week, Butterfly Network, Inc. reported record second-quarter 2026 results, with revenue rising to US$32.61 million from US$23.38 million a year earlier and net loss narrowing to US$12.91 million, while also issuing third-quarter revenue guidance of US$26 million to US$30 million.
  • The company raised its full-year 2026 revenue outlook to US$119 million–US$123 million, underpinned by very large Embedded segment growth, new partnerships, and improved gross margins.

Butterfly Network Investment Narrative Recap

To own Butterfly Network, I think you need to believe its handheld and embedded ultrasound platform can grow into a much larger business while steadily narrowing losses. The latest record Q2 revenue and raised 2026 outlook support the near term catalyst of accelerating Embedded adoption, but the company is still loss making, so the biggest current risk remains ongoing cash burn and the possibility that sales cycles or funding pressures slow the ramp needed to justify that spending.

The clearest tie between this quarter and the broader story is the upgraded full year 2026 revenue guidance to US$119 million to US$123 million, which leans heavily on Embedded segment momentum and improving gross margins. That outlook sits against a share price that already reflects high growth expectations and a rich price to sales multiple, so how well Butterfly converts its new partnerships and embedded wins into repeatable, higher margin revenues is central to the near term thesis.

Yet beneath the strong headline numbers, there is still the question of whether ongoing losses and cash usage could eventually force moves that existing shareholders should be aware of...

Butterfly Network's narrative projects $238.3 million revenue and $7.3 million earnings by 2029. This requires 32.3% yearly revenue growth and an $83.1 million earnings increase from -$75.8 million today.
